在数字时代,网站流量是衡量一个网站成功与否的重要指标。无论是企业还是个人,提升网站流量都意味着更多的曝光、更高的转化率和更广泛的用户基础。以下是一些实战中的搜索引擎优化(SEO)秘籍,帮助你实现网站流量的翻倍增长。
了解SEO的基础
1. 关键词研究
关键词是SEO的核心。了解你的目标受众在搜索引擎中搜索什么,可以帮助你优化网站内容和元数据。
# 示例:使用Python进行关键词研究
import requests
from bs4 import BeautifulSoup
def search_keywords(search_term):
url = f"https://www.google.com/search?q={search_term}"
response = requests.get(url)
soup = BeautifulSoup(response.text, 'html.parser')
keywords = [tag.text for tag in soup.find_all('a') if 'href' in tag.attrs]
return keywords
keywords = search_keywords("SEO最佳实践")
print(keywords)
2. 网站结构优化
确保网站结构清晰,便于搜索引擎抓取和索引。使用适当的HTML标签和导航链接。
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>我的网站</title>
</head>
<body>
<header>
<nav>
<ul>
<li><a href="#home">首页</a></li>
<li><a href="#about">关于我们</a></li>
<li><a href="#services">服务</a></li>
<li><a href="#contact">联系方式</a></li>
</ul>
</nav>
</header>
<main>
<section id="home">
<h1>欢迎来到我的网站</h1>
</section>
<!-- 其他内容 -->
</main>
</body>
</html>
提升内容质量
1. 高质量原创内容
提供有价值、有深度的内容,让用户愿意阅读并分享。
# SEO实战技巧
在SEO的世界里,内容为王。以下是一些提升内容质量的技巧:
1. **深入研究主题**:确保你对所写主题有深入的了解。
2. **使用高质量图片和视频**:视觉元素可以增加用户的停留时间。
3. **优化长尾关键词**:专注于那些长尾关键词,它们可能带来更精准的流量。
2. 优化页面加载速度
页面加载速度是影响用户体验和SEO排名的重要因素。
// 示例:使用JavaScript优化页面加载速度
document.addEventListener("DOMContentLoaded", function() {
console.log("页面加载完成");
});
外部链接建设
1. 获取高质量反向链接
反向链接是搜索引擎判断网站权威性的重要依据。
# 示例:使用Python获取反向链接
import requests
def get_backlinks(url):
response = requests.get(f"https://www.ahrefs.com/api/backlinks/{url}")
backlinks = response.json()
return backlinks
backlinks = get_backlinks("https://www.yourwebsite.com")
print(backlinks)
2. 社交媒体推广
利用社交媒体平台分享你的内容,吸引更多的用户和链接。
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>分享到社交媒体</title>
</head>
<body>
<a href="https://www.facebook.com/sharer/sharer.php?u=https://www.yourwebsite.com" target="_blank">分享到Facebook</a>
<a href="https://twitter.com/intent/tweet?url=https://www.yourwebsite.com" target="_blank">分享到Twitter</a>
<!-- 其他社交媒体 -->
</body>
</html>
监控和分析
1. 使用SEO工具
使用工具如Google Analytics和Google Search Console来监控你的SEO表现。
// 示例:使用Google Analytics跟踪网站流量
(function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
(i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
})(window,document,'script','https://www.google-analytics.com/analytics.js','ga');
ga('create', 'YOUR_TRACKING_ID', 'auto');
ga('send', 'pageview');
2. 定期调整策略
SEO是一个持续的过程,需要根据数据和反馈不断调整策略。
通过上述实战秘籍,你可以逐步提升你的网站流量。记住,SEO不是一夜之间可以看到成效的,需要耐心和持续的努力。
